Norwegian company Remarkable’s electronic paper tablet may pose competition for premium tablets such as Apple, Samsung, and Lenovo in the Indian market. Indian experts believe that Remarkable’s device for note-taking and reading can capture the attention of Indian students in top-tier cities. The device is designed to be a simple gadget without internet capabilities, appealing to parents who want to divert their children’s attention away from internet browsing, phone calls, text messages, games, and other applications. Specialists also suggest that the brand should collaborate with educational institutions such as schools and colleges in top-tier cities to enter the B2B market.

Remarkable, based in Oslo, Norway, has created a unique product – an electronic paper tablet that allows users to write and take notes, read, and view documents. The device operates on a patented operating system that does not offer internet browsing, emailing, messaging, or other features typical of tablets and smartphones. Instead, users can convert manually written notes into computer-generated text.

The device also allows for combining and rearranging handwritten notes, inputting text on the same page, annotating directly on PDF files and e-books, organizing notes and documents with folders and tags, and converting handwritten notes into machine text.

In the Indian market, Remarkable is focusing on the premium segment, offering devices priced below 45,000 Rs, currently only available online. The company plans to expand distribution and after-sales service to a wide physical retail network, which constitutes nearly half of the Indian market.

Existing brands such as Apple, Samsung, Lenovo, and RealMe already provide competition for Remarkable. According to data from research firm CyberMedia Research, Apple and Samsung were close leaders in the second quarter of 2023, holding 25.38% and 25.31% market shares, respectively, with Lenovo in third place. Tablet sales during the same period declined by 22% year over year.

Mats Herding Solberg, Director of Design and Product Management at Remarkable, said that during the India launch day on January 15, 2024, nearly 100,000 people from India visited remarkable.com. This was more than the number of Americans who visited our website on Black Friday. The United States is the largest market for Remarkable.

Solberg added that in 2023, without any marketing efforts, 250,000 people from India visited remarkables.com, indicating organic interest in our product in India. Currently, Remarkable imports fully assembled units from China to all markets, including India.
